COSMOSWorks Designer Training

 
catalyst now
   bullet
   
   
   
   
 
 
 
 
 
 
 

This course helps students understand static analysis from elementary level. Students analyze CAD designs using existing SolidWorks part models. Such a structural analysis allows the determination of effects such as deformations, strains, and stresses which are caused by applied structural loads such as force, pressure and gravity. These results can then be studied using visualization tools within FEA environment to view and to fully identify implications of the analysis.

Topics Covered

  • Pre processing : defining the finite element model and environmental factors to be applied to it
    • set up boundary conditions
    • use/create material libraries
    • understand mesh types/uses
  • Analysis solver (solution of finite element model)
    • Advantages/uses of different solvers
  • Post-processing of results
    • using visualization tools
    • compare results from multiple analysis
  • FEA  modeling strategy
  • Run parametric studies
  • Analyze assemblies with gaps, contact and friction
  • Simulate bolts / springs / pins / hinges
  • Failure conditions
  • Convergence and accuracy
